Buying Corporate Bonds in the primary market or during the Offer Period requires the submission of the following: Purchasing: Application to Purchase form, PDTC Specimen Signature Sheet, valid government ID and corporate documents for corporate investors Buying and selling the Corporate Bonds in the secondary market requires the submission of the following: Purchasing: Investor Registration Form, Letter of Instruction (LOI) for Peso Fixed Income Securities and PDTC Specimen Signature Sheet Selling: Trade Related Transfer Form, Letter of Instruction (LOI) for Peso Fixed Income Securities and Confirmation of Sale Note: Additional documents may be required by the Bank or Custodian to facilitate the execution of the transaction.
